Early Beginnings (1994 – 2000)

The Birth of Online Gambling

The first real money online casino was launched in 1994 by Microgaming, a software development company based in the Isle of Man. This marked a significant milestone in the gambling industry as it opened the doors for players to gamble from the comfort of their homes. By 1996, there were about fifteen online casinos operating.

Legal Challenges in the US

Meanwhile, in the United States, the legal status of online gambling was murky. In 1998, the Interactive Gambling Act was introduced to regulate online gambling activities, but it was never passed. This period of uncertainty led many players to experience a range of online casinos, but not all were reliable. Players thus had to be cautious in selecting a casino.

The Boom Years (2001 – 2010)

Explosion of Popularity

The turn of the century saw exponential growth in the popularity of online casinos. The introduction of user-friendly interfaces and enhanced security protocols made online gambling more appealing. By 2006, it was reported that there were over 2,000 online gambling sites, catering to millions of players worldwide.

The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act (2006)

A significant event that influenced US players occurred in 2006 with the passage of the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act (UIGEA). This law prohibited financial institutions from processing transactions related to online gambling. Many casinos began to exit the US market, leaving players seeking new platforms and alternatives.

The Modern Era (2011 – Present)

Legalization and Regulation

The tides began to turn in the early 2010s, with several states, including New Jersey, Nevada, and Delaware, legalizing online poker and casino games. The New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ement began issuing licenses in 2013, paving the way for regulated online casinos for US players.

Technological Advancements

Technological innovations such as mobile gaming and live dealer games further enriched the online casino experience. In 2016, a report indicated that mobile gambling was set to become a trillion-dollar industry, reflecting the trend’s popularity among players.
